在一个视图中输出两个数组(Kohana)


Output two array in one view (Kohana)


我有一个控制器,需要在一个视图文件中输出,并且$_GET参数
控制器代码为:

    public function action_register_final() {
    //Detect view file
    $block_center = View::factory('pages/v_register_final');
    $block_center = $this->request->param('user_id');
    //Detect block
    $this->template->block_center = array($block_center);
    }

但此代码仅输出$_GET参数。。。如果我移除$block_center=$this->request->param('user_id')视图加载良好并输出。我知道我替换了$block_center,但我如何才能输出这两个值
Thx

观看。您覆盖了您的变量。我想你需要这个:

public function action_register_final()
{
    // Detect view file
    $this->template = View::factory('pages/v_register_final');
    $this->template->block_center = array($this->request->param('user_id'));
}

或者。

public function action_register_final()
{
    // Detect view file
    $this->template = View::factory('pages/v_register_final');
    $block_center = this->request->param('user_id');
    $this->template->block_center = array($block_center);
}

未经测试。这就是你需要的?你的第二个阵列在哪里?尝试合并。